.search_box{padding:40px 0}.search_left ul{margin-top:5px}.search_left ul li{font-size:16px;color:#282828;margin-right:5px}.search_left ul li a{color:#282828}.search_left ul li a:hover{color:#8fb6d8}.search_right{padding-left:48px;background:url("../images/index//tel_icon.png") no-repeat left top}.search_right h4{color:#5c5c5c}.search_right h1{font-size:28px;color:#282828;letter-spacing:0}.solution_left{width:400px}.solution_left .t_btn{margin-top:85px}.solution_swiper{width:960px}.solution_list li{margin-left:40px;width:440px}.solution_list li:hover h1{color:#8fb6d8}.solution_list li:hover img{transform:scale(1.2);-webkit-transform:scale(1.2);-o-transform:scale(1.2);-ms-transform:scale(1.2);-moz-transform:scale(1.2)}.solution_list .imgs_box{width:440px;height:206px}.solution_list .imgs_box img{max-width:440px;max-height:206px}.solution_info{padding:15px 20px 40px 45px;position:relative}.solution_info span{display:block;position:absolute;left:0;top:15px;font-size:20px;width:36px;height:36px;line-height:36px;text-align:center;background:#8fb6d8;color:#fff}.solution_info h1{font-weight:bold;color:#282828;font-size:30px;line-height:1;margin-bottom:15px}.solution_info h3{color:#282828}.solution_btn{margin-top:100px}.solution_btn span{display:inline-block;width:30px;height:30px;margin-right:5px}.solution_prev{background:url("../images/index/left_icon.png") no-repeat;background-size:100% 100%;-moz-background-size:100% 100%;-o-background-size:100% 100%;-ms-background-size:100% 100%;-webkit-background-size:100% 100%}.solution_prev:hover{background:url("../images/index/left_active_icon.png") no-repeat;background-size:100% 100%;-moz-background-size:100% 100%;-o-background-size:100% 100%;-ms-background-size:100% 100%;-webkit-background-size:100% 100%}.solution_next{background:url("../images/index/right_icon.png") no-repeat;background-size:100% 100%;-moz-background-size:100% 100%;-o-background-size:100% 100%;-ms-background-size:100% 100%;-webkit-background-size:100% 100%}.solution_next:hover{background:url("../images/index/right_active_icon.png") no-repeat;background-size:100% 100%;-moz-background-size:100% 100%;-o-background-size:100% 100%;-ms-background-size:100% 100%;-webkit-background-size:100% 100%}.case_title{padding:40px 0}.case_title .t_btn{margin-top:20px;background:#373737}.case_tab li{margin-left:25px}.case_tab li:hover a::after,.case_tab li.active a::after{transform:translateX(-50%) scale(1);-webkit-transform:translateX(-50%) scale(1);-moz-transform:translateX(-50%) scale(1);-ms-transform:translateX(-50%) scale(1);-o-transform:translateX(-50%) scale(1)}.case_tab li a{font-weight:bold;display:block;color:#282828;font-size:20px;position:relative;line-height:46px;height:46px;position:relative}.case_tab li a::after{display:block;content:"";width:20px;height:2px;background:#8fb6d8;position:absolute;left:50%;bottom:0;transform:translateX(-50%) scale(0);-webkit-transform:translateX(-50%) scale(0);-moz-transform:translateX(-50%) scale(0);-ms-transform:translateX(-50%) scale(0);-o-transform:translateX(-50%) scale(0);transform-origin:50% 50%;-webkit-transform-origin:50% 50%;-moz-transform-origin:50% 50%;-o-transform-origin:50% 50%;-ms-transform-origin:50% 50%;-webkit-transition:transform .5s linear;-moz-transition:transform .5s linear;-o-transition:transform .5s linear;-ms-transition:transform .5s linear;transition:transform .5s linear}.case_container{padding-bottom:40px}.case_container img{width:100%;height:100%}.case_container .imgs_box{position:relative}.case_container .imgs_box:hover .case_info{display:-webkit-box;display:-moz-box;display:-ms-flexbox;display:-webkit-flex;display:flex}.case_item .imgs_box{width:250px;height:250px}.case_item .imgs_box+.imgs_box{margin-top:25px}.case_big_item{width:525px;height:525px}.case_info{position:absolute;left:0;top:0;width:100%;height:100%;background:rgba(0,0,0,0.6);display:none}.case_info h2{color:#fff;padding:0 15px}.product_swiper>div{padding-bottom:40px}.product_list li{width:20%}.product_list .imgs_box{background:#fff;border:1px solid #eee;box-sizing:border-box;width:100%;height:400px}.product_list .imgs_box img{max-width:99%;max-height:380px}.product_list h3{color:#282828;font-weight:bold;line-height:40px;padding:0 10px;text-align:center}.service_box{padding-bottom:80px}.service_box .t_btn{margin:20px auto 0;background:#373737}.gad_box{padding-bottom:40px;background:#f6f6f6}.gad_list li{margin:0 10px 20px;width:320px;background:#fff;box-sizing:border-box;padding:45px 35px;-webkit-transition:transform .5s linear;-moz-transition:transform .5s linear;-o-transition:transform .5s linear;-ms-transition:transform .5s linear;transition:transform .5s linear}.gad_list li:hover{-moz-box-shadow:4px 4px 10px rgba(0,0,0,0.02),-4px 4px 10px rgba(0,0,0,0.02),4px -4px 10px rgba(0,0,0,0.02),-4px -4px 10px rgba(0,0,0,0.02);-webkit-box-shadow:4px 4px 10px rgba(0,0,0,0.02),-4px 4px 10px rgba(0,0,0,0.02),4px -4px 10px rgba(0,0,0,0.02),-4px -4px 10px rgba(0,0,0,0.02);box-shadow:4px 4px 10px rgba(0,0,0,0.02),-4px 4px 10px rgba(0,0,0,0.02),4px -4px 10px rgba(0,0,0,0.02),-4px -4px 10px rgba(0,0,0,0.02);transform:translateY(-5px);-webkit-transform:translateY(-5px);-moz-transform:translateY(-5px);-ms-transform:translateY(-5px);-o-transform:translateY(-5px)}.gad_list li::before{display:block;content:"";width:58px;height:58px}.gad_list h1{margin:20px 0;font-weight:bold;color:#282828;font-size:30px}.gad_list h3{font-size:18px;color:#282828}.gad_item_1::before{background:url("../images/index//gad_icon_1.png") no-repeat;background-size:100% 100%;-moz-background-size:100% 100%;-o-background-size:100% 100%;-ms-background-size:100% 100%;-webkit-background-size:100% 100%}.gad_item_2::before{background:url("../images/index//gad_icon_2.png") no-repeat;background-size:100% 100%;-moz-background-size:100% 100%;-o-background-size:100% 100%;-ms-background-size:100% 100%;-webkit-background-size:100% 100%}.gad_item_3::before{background:url("../images/index//gad_icon_3.png") no-repeat;background-size:100% 100%;-moz-background-size:100% 100%;-o-background-size:100% 100%;-ms-background-size:100% 100%;-webkit-background-size:100% 100%}.gad_item_4::before{background:url("../images/index//gad_icon_4.png") no-repeat;background-size:100% 100%;-moz-background-size:100% 100%;-o-background-size:100% 100%;-ms-background-size:100% 100%;-webkit-background-size:100% 100%}.gad_item_5::before{background:url("../images/index//gad_icon_5.png") no-repeat;background-size:100% 100%;-moz-background-size:100% 100%;-o-background-size:100% 100%;-ms-background-size:100% 100%;-webkit-background-size:100% 100%}.gad_item_6::before{width:65px !important;background:url("../images/index//gad_icon_6.png") no-repeat;background-size:100% 100%;-moz-background-size:100% 100%;-o-background-size:100% 100%;-ms-background-size:100% 100%;-webkit-background-size:100% 100%}.gad_item_7::before{background:url("../images/index//gad_icon_7.png") no-repeat;background-size:100% 100%;-moz-background-size:100% 100%;-o-background-size:100% 100%;-ms-background-size:100% 100%;-webkit-background-size:100% 100%}.gad_item_8::before{background:url("../images/index//gad_icon_8.png") no-repeat;background-size:100% 100%;-moz-background-size:100% 100%;-o-background-size:100% 100%;-ms-background-size:100% 100%;-webkit-background-size:100% 100%}.process_box{height:494px;background:url("../images/index/process_bg.png") no-repeat center}.about_box{min-height:918px;background:url("../images/index/about_bg.png") no-repeat center}.about_info{width:500px;padding-top:170px}.about_info p{margin:15px 0 100px;text-indent:2em;color:#666666;font-size:16px;line-height:1.8}.about_list{padding:35px 0}.about_list li{margin-right:20px;text-align:center}.about_list h1{font-weight:bold;color:#282828;position:relative;font-size:32px}.about_list h1 span{color:#666666;font-size:14px;position:absolute;right:-8px;top:-8px}.about_list h5{color:#666666}.news_box .index_Sub{position:relative}.news_box .index_Sub::after{display:block;content:"";width:700px;height:1px;background:#eee;z-index:2;position:absolute;left:120%;top:50%;transform:translateY(-58%);-webkit-transform:translateY(-58%);-moz-transform:translateY(-58%);-ms-transform:translateY(-58%);-o-transform:translateY(-58%)}.news_swiper>div{margin-bottom:50px;padding-bottom:80px}.news_list li{width:32%;margin:0 0.66666%}.news_list li:hover h4{color:#8fb6d8}.news_list li:hover img{transform:scale(1.2);-webkit-transform:scale(1.2);-o-transform:scale(1.2);-ms-transform:scale(1.2);-moz-transform:scale(1.2)}.news_list .imgs_box{width:100%;height:315px}.news_list .imgs_box img{max-width:100%;max-height:315px}.news_list h4{margin:35px 0 10px;color:#282828;font-weight:bold}.news_list h6{color:#888888}.news_list h5{color:#888888;margin-top:20px;font-size:14px}.panoramic{position:relative;overflow:hidden}.panoramic .txt{position:absolute;top:20%;text-align:center;z-index:10;left:50%;transform:translateX(-50%);color:#fff;font-size:1.5em;width:80%}.panoramic .txt h4{padding-bottom:30px;position:relative;margin-bottom:25px}.panoramic .txt h4::after{content:"";position:absolute;left:50%;bottom:0;height:5px;background:#f2584e;width:40px;margin-left:-20px}.panoramic .txt h4 span{display:block;font-size:4.2em;font-family:Arial;line-height:1;font-weight:bold}.panoramic .menu span{margin:0 15px;cursor:pointer}.panoramic .menu .on{color:#f2584e}.panoramic li,.panoramic iframe{width:100%;height:650px}.panoramic li{position:relative;display:none}.panoramic li.on{display:list-item}.panoramic li .btn{position:absolute;width:160px;height:60px;line-height:60px;text-align:center;bottom:100px;left:50%;margin-left:-80px;background:#f2584e;color:#fff;z-index:2}.panoramic li .btn:hover{background:#cb2d23;width:240px;margin-left:-120px}.panoramic li::after{content:"";position:absolute;left:0;top:0px;width:100%;height:100%;background:rgba(0,0,0,0.7)}
